Output 59640ba86663fca6ed4c567e0dc2846c767caec4ea802c99aad6971503868c03:1

value
1710682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d667a489a77b32d80e9833e18b3250b375b3f8cd OP_EQUAL
address
3MEggpQvWoFpcWwosJZvFz8qxtNXV5Kzr3
transaction
59640ba86663fca6ed4c567e0dc2846c767caec4ea802c99aad6971503868c03
spent
true